Immunology Letters provides a vehicle for the speedy publication of full-length and short articles, Rapid Notes, (mini)Reviews and Letters to the Editor addressing all aspects of molecular and cellular immunology. The essential criteria for publication will be clarity, experimental soundness and novelty. Results contradictory to current accepted thinking or ideas divergent from actual dogmas will be considered for publication provided that they are based on solid experimental findings. Preference will be given to papers of immediate importance to other investigators, either by their experimental data, new ideas or new methodology. Scientific correspondence to the Editor-in-Chief related to the published papers may also be accepted provided that they are short and scientifically relevant to the papers mentioned, in order to provide a continuing forum for discussion. Within a reference section, new mRNA sequences with unknown function, expressed sequence tags with tissue distribution and novel monoclonal antibody descriptions are considered for publication.
